Well there are plenty of names out there, so where to start!
How about naming him after a local landscape feature (either near you or near his original home) such as a mountain or river, etc?
Or a character from Welsh literature that you like? If he’s a bit anxious, how about Pryderi (from the Mabinogi) which doubles as a pun on pryderu (to be anxious)!
What colour is he? Does that influence a name? (e.g. if a lot of white, perhaps a name with ‘wyn’ in it).

If you come across a name you like but want to check out its meaning, let me know and I’ll check my “welsh names” and “Welsh place names” books when I get home!

My dog came from a rescue shelter with the name ‘Lucky’, so we just translated it to ‘Lwcus’ - he didn’t seem to mind (or indeed notice!).

I thought that sheep dogs, if they were working dogs usually had very short names, like cai etc. I like Pero which actually crops up in lots of old Welsh songs, which refer to sheep dogs, but I think for some reason that was from Spanish originally - not sure why Welsh farmers would use a Spanish name for a dog, but maybe someone knows.

found a link (http://kimkat.org/amryw/1_vortaroy/geiriadur_cymraeg_saesneg_BAEDD_ci_1675e.html)
that said this:

ci, cŵn ‹kii, kuun› (masculine noun)
1 dog = Canis familiaris common quadraped
Typical dogs’ names in Welsh are Pero, Carlo, Cymro, Cardi, Ianto, Tango, Smot

Call it Funky. Works on two levels:

  1. English, funky, obviously
  2. Welsh as “fy nghi” - “my dog”
